Austin Oswald Abaho, a 26-year-old health worker, attached to Nyakibale Karoli Lwanga Hospital in Rukungiri district, lost his life in a motorcycle accident in the early hours of Sunday morning.

Abaho had completed his duty at the hospital around 1:00 AM and was riding a motorcycle registration number UDY 134Y from Rukungiri town to his residence in Kebisoni town council. However, the motorcycle hit a deep pothole in the middle of the road near Katoogo, along the Rukungiri-Ntungamo road a few kilometers after Rukungiri town.
